College of Southern Idaho Veterinary/Animal Health Technologies/Technicians Associate’s Degrees

During the most recent reporting year, College of Southern Idaho conferred 15 associate’s degrees in veterinary/animal health technologies/technicians.

Associate’s Student Diversity

For the most recent academic year available, 7% of veterinary/animal health technologies/technicians associate’s degrees went to men and 93% went to women.

College of Southern Idaho gender breakdown of Veterinary/Animal Health Technologies/Technicians Associate's degree grads The largest share of veterinary/animal health technologies/technicians associate’s degree graduates at College of Southern Idaho are White. Roughly 93% of graduates fell into this category.
